Automation of attention in virtual classroom: An approach from a process of technological surveillance
The automation of attention in the virtual classroom and its impact on the teaching-learning process has become a necessity for higher education institutions that work under this modality, and where currently this type of teaching and methodology has been increasing in partly due to the global pandemic that took place in 2020.
This document will show a technological surveillance process as an approach to review the impact of these automation processes and the use of artificial intelligence tools on virtual campuses, for which a technological surveillance tool and various monitoring tools are used. bibliographic analysis.
